1960 Nissan Cedric vs. 2007 Holden UTE

To start off, 2007 Holden UTE is newer by 47 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1960 Nissan Cedric.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1960 Nissan Cedric would be higher. At 6,000 cc (8 cylinders), 2007 Holden UTE is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Holden UTE (357 HP) has 297 more horse power than 1960 Nissan Cedric. (60 HP) In normal driving conditions, 2007 Holden UTE should accelerate faster than 1960 Nissan Cedric.

Let's talk about torque, 2007 Holden UTE (530 Nm) has 414 more torque (in Nm) than 1960 Nissan Cedric. (116 Nm). This means 2007 Holden UTE will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1960 Nissan Cedric.
